142,Double和Float
来源:互联网 发布:网络奇兵武器 编辑:程序博客网 时间:2024/05/27 03:30
1,Double和Float的概述
>Double是64位浮点数,而Float是32位浮点数
>如果没有明确说明数据类型,浮点数默认就是Double
let num = 3.14//没有说明数据类型,num默认是Double类型
2,Double和Float的表示方式
>十进制数:
>十六进制(以0o为前缀,且一定要指数)
var num = 0x12 * 10^2
3,数字格式
>数据可以增加额外的格式,使它们更容易阅读,并不影响其数值大小
>增加额外的0
>可以增加额外的下划线_
var oneMillion = 000002000
var oneMillion1 = 2_000
var oneMillion2 = 000_002_000
4,数据运算
>两个不同数据类型的数值运算,不能直接运算,只能强制转成同一类型,才能运算
var num1:Int =1;
var num2:Double =1.2;
var result:Double =Double(num1) +num2;
-------------------------------
var result:Double =1 + 2.1;
0 0
- 142,Double和Float
- 关于float和double
- float 和 double
- float 和 double
- double 和float区别
- 关于 float 和double
- Double 和 Float
- float和double
- float和double
- float和double
- c/c++: float和double、long double
- c/c++: float和double、long double
- Java的float和double
- float 和 double 精度问题
- double和float的区别
- java中的float和double
- float和double速度对比
- double和float的区别
- Java设计模式 状态模式(State)
- 遍历结果集,执行20条insert语句
- Python 换行符转换
- 文本分类与SVM
- SSL/OPENSSL笔记
- 142,Double和Float
- Linux init.d
- 车辆磨合篇
- (小笔记) android 直接拨打电话和进入拨打电话界面
- 进程的虚拟内存,物理内存,共享内存
- qmake 命令浅析
- Type 'jstring' could not be resolved.bug解决 eclips android jni mac
- 打印助手-打印暂停/开始问题原因调研记录
- SharedPreferenceUtil